在当今数据驱动的时代,企业若想在激烈的市场竞争中立于不败之地,趋势分析已成为不可或缺的技能。然而,如何有效地利用开源工具进行趋势分析,却是许多企业面临的难题。选择合适的工具,能够帮助企业更敏锐地把握市场脉搏,提前预判未来趋势,并制定出更具竞争力的商业策略。本文将深入探讨如何利用开源工具进行趋势分析,并推荐2025年的最佳解决方案。通过结合实际案例和权威数据,为您揭开开源趋势分析工具的神秘面纱。

📈 一、开源工具的选择关键因素
选择适合的开源工具不仅仅是为了节省成本,更重要的是这些工具能够满足特定的分析需求。以下是选择开源工具时需要考虑的几个关键因素:

1. 功能覆盖与扩展能力
在选择开源工具时,首要考虑的便是其提供的功能和扩展能力。功能完善的工具能够帮助企业全面分析数据,提供准确的趋势预测。例如,工具的可视化功能、数据处理能力、兼容性等,都是企业需要重点考量的方面。
工具名称 | 功能覆盖 | 扩展能力 | 兼容性 | 用户社区支持 |
---|---|---|---|---|
Tool A | 高 | 高 | 强 | 强 |
Tool B | 中 | 中 | 中 | 中 |
Tool C | 低 | 高 | 弱 | 强 |
- 功能覆盖:确保所选工具能够支持从数据采集到分析的完整流程。
- 扩展能力:优先选择支持插件扩展的工具,以便根据企业未来需求进行功能扩展。
- 兼容性:工具应能无缝集成到现有的IT基础设施中。
2. 数据处理能力与性能表现
数据处理能力和性能表现是开源工具的核心竞争力。企业需要确保工具能够处理大规模数据,且在高并发情况下仍能保持优异的性能表现。
数据处理能力主要体现在数据清洗、转换、加载(ETL)等方面。开源工具应具备高效的数据处理管道,确保在最短时间内完成数据处理。此外,性能表现还包括查询速度、实时分析能力等。企业需要根据自身的数据量和实时性需求,选择合适的工具。
- 数据清洗:工具需具备强大的数据清洗功能,以清除数据中的噪音,提高数据质量。
- 实时分析:支持实时数据流分析,以便快速响应市场变化。
3. 用户社区与支持
一个活跃的用户社区意味着工具会有持续的更新和技术支持。社区的活跃程度直接影响到工具的稳定性和未来发展。选择拥有强大社区支持的开源工具,可以确保在遇到问题时,能够快速获得解决方案。
- 文档与教程:工具应提供详尽的使用文档和教程,帮助用户快速上手。
- 社区活跃度:活跃的社区意味着更多的插件、扩展和问题解决方案。
🧩 二、2025年最佳开源趋势分析工具推荐
在众多开源工具中,哪些是2025年最值得推荐的呢?以下是经过市场调研和用户反馈,优选出的几款工具。
1. Apache Superset
Apache Superset 是一款强大的数据可视化和业务分析工具,其直观的界面和丰富的图表选项使其成为用户的宠儿。它不仅支持多种数据源,还能通过SQL Lab功能实现复杂的数据查询,非常适合那些需要灵活分析和快速决策的企业。
功能模块 | 描述 |
---|---|
数据可视化 | 提供丰富的图表选项,支持自定义 |
数据源支持 | 支持多种数据库连接 |
SQL 查询 | 内置 SQL Lab,支持复杂查询 |
- 数据可视化:用户可以通过拖拽的方式创建图表,直观展示数据趋势。
- SQL Lab:支持即席查询,用户可以实时分析数据,快速响应业务需求。
- 插件支持:通过插件扩展功能,用户可以根据需要添加新的可视化组件。
2. Metabase
Metabase 是一款简单易用的开源BI工具,致力于让每个团队成员都能轻松提问和分析数据。无需编写复杂的SQL语句,用户即可通过直观的界面进行数据探索和可视化。
- 用户友好:界面简洁,用户无需专业的数据分析技能即可上手。
- 自动化报告:支持定时生成报告,帮助团队定期追踪关键指标。
- 问题解决:用户可以通过提问的方式,快速获取数据洞察。
🛠️ 三、利用开源工具进行趋势分析的实战指南
选择了合适的工具之后,如何有效地进行趋势分析呢?以下是一些实用的实战指南。
1. 数据准备与清洗
数据的准备与清洗是趋势分析的前提。在进行分析之前,确保数据的准确性和一致性至关重要。企业应构建完善的数据准备流程,以确保数据能够准确反映业务现状。
- 数据清洗:去除重复数据、修正错误数据,确保数据质量。
- 数据转换:根据分析需求,将数据转换为合适的格式。
- 数据集成:整合来自不同来源的数据,以便进行综合分析。
2. 数据可视化与洞察发现
数据可视化是趋势分析的重要环节。通过图表、仪表盘等方式,用户可以直观地看到数据的变化趋势,从而快速做出决策。
- 仪表盘:创建实时更新的仪表盘,帮助决策者直观查看关键指标。
- 趋势图表:通过折线图、柱状图等图表,展示数据的变化趋势。
- 互动分析:支持用户与数据进行互动,深入挖掘数据中的潜在模式。
3. 趋势预测与决策支持
在完成数据可视化后,企业需要根据分析结果进行趋势预测。预测不仅帮助企业提前布局市场,也为战略决策提供重要依据。

- 机器学习模型:利用机器学习算法,建立预测模型,提高预测准确性。
- 情景分析:模拟不同情景下的业务表现,帮助企业制定应对策略。
- 决策支持:结合分析结果,为企业决策提供数据支持。
🏁 结论
在这个数据为王的时代,利用开源工具进行趋势分析已经成为企业获取竞争优势的关键手段。无论是通过 Apache Superset 的强大数据可视化功能,还是 Metabase 的用户友好体验,企业都能在激烈的市场竞争中占据有利地位。选择合适的工具,并结合实用的分析方法,企业将能更好地把握市场趋势,制定更加精准的商业策略。
参考文献:
- 《数据分析实战:从入门到精通》,张三,2022。
- 《商业智能与数据仓库》,李四,2021。
- 《机器学习与数据挖掘》,王五,2023。
本文相关FAQs
📊 如何选择适合企业的开源趋势分析工具?
老板让我研究开源工具进行趋势分析,但市面上工具太多,感觉无从下手。有没有大佬能分享一下如何选择适合企业的开源工具?特别是需要支持大数据处理和复杂分析需求的。
选择开源工具进行趋势分析确实需要仔细考虑,因为企业的需求、数据量和技术储备都可能影响最终的决定。首先,明确企业的分析需求是关键。你需要知道企业是希望分析历史数据、预测未来趋势,还是仅仅进行简单的数据可视化。常见的开源工具如Apache Kafka、ElasticSearch和Apache Spark等各有其优势。
Apache Kafka适合实时数据流分析,处理大量数据传输和实时处理。ElasticSearch则在全文搜索和分析方面表现出色,适用于需要快速检索和分析海量数据的场景。Apache Spark则以其强大的分布式计算能力,适合处理大数据集并进行复杂的机器学习任务。
在选择过程中,还需考虑以下几点:
- 社区活跃度:活跃的社区意味着工具的持续更新和丰富的资源支持。
- 技术栈兼容性:确保工具能够无缝集成到现有的技术栈中。
- 学习曲线:评估团队的学习能力和工具的复杂程度。
- 性能和可扩展性:根据数据规模选择性能强劲且可扩展的工具。
通过这些指标的分析,你可以更有把握地选择适合企业需求的开源工具。
🔍 如何用开源工具进行深度数据挖掘实现商业洞察?
了解了如何选择工具,接下来,我想深入了解如何利用这些开源工具进行数据挖掘,以便从数据中获取有价值的商业洞察。有没有一些实操的建议?
数据挖掘是一项复杂但非常有价值的任务,它能够帮助企业从海量数据中获取有价值的洞察。为了实现这一目标,选对工具只是第一步,更重要的是如何有效使用这些工具。以Apache Spark为例,其强大的分布式计算能力使其在数据挖掘中大放异彩。Spark提供了MLlib库,支持多种机器学习算法,如聚类、分类、回归等,这些都可以用于深度数据挖掘。
以下是一些实操建议:
- 数据准备:确保数据清洗和预处理到位,这影响到后续分析的准确性。
- 选择合适的算法:根据业务需求选择合适的算法。比如,聚类分析可以帮助识别客户群体,分类算法可用于预测用户行为。
- 持续迭代优化:数据挖掘是一个持续优化的过程,不断调整算法参数和数据集以提高模型的准确性。
- 结果验证:利用交叉验证等方法验证模型的准确性,确保分析结果的可靠性。
在整个过程中,FineBI等商业智能工具可以作为补充,帮助团队更直观地展示和分享分析结果, FineBI在线试用 可以让你体验其强大的数据可视化和协作功能。
🚀 2025年趋势分析的未来发展方向有哪些?
在掌握了工具选择和数据挖掘技巧之后,未来趋势分析领域会有哪些新的发展方向?我们需要提前做好哪些准备?
展望2025年,趋势分析将向着更智能、更自动化的方向发展。随着人工智能和机器学习技术的不断进步,趋势分析不再仅仅依赖于历史数据的分析和模型预测,而是开始利用智能算法进行更深层次的数据理解和业务预测。
未来的趋势分析可能会包括:
- 增强分析(Augmented Analytics):通过自然语言处理和机器学习,让数据分析更加自动化和智能化,降低对专业技术人员的依赖。
- 实时数据分析:随着物联网设备的普及,实时数据分析将变得更加重要,企业需要处理不断涌入的数据流以做出快速决策。
- 数据可视化的创新:不仅限于传统图表,新兴的数据可视化技术将提供更具互动性和洞察力的呈现方式。
- 数据隐私与安全性:在日益严格的数据法规下,如何在进行趋势分析的同时保护用户隐私将成为重要课题。
企业应关注这些趋势,并逐步培养内部的数据分析能力和技术储备,以便在未来的竞争中占据有利位置。通过不断的学习和技术更新,企业可以更好地应对未来的挑战并抓住机遇。